Basel II (The International Convergence of Capital Measurement and Capital Standards: A Revised Framework1), is the second of the Basel Accords and poses minimum capital requirements. In line with the framework, financial companies must assess their operational, market and credit risks and form capital reserves to cover these risks. A portion of these requirements, which deal specifically with credit and market risks, were already addressed in the first Basel Accord. This paper analyzes the requirements of Basel II in terms of operational risks, the structure of these risks and their influence on a company's information infrastructure.
